Opportunities arise from grad school skill sets

AU alum Keosha Johnson met with students to discuss her life after grad school. After earning a competitive internship with NBC News in New York City, Johnson had several opportunities open up to her because of the skills she learned while at American University.

While working on the American Observer, the online magazine run by the journalism students, Johnson learned some Web production skills that made her resume stand out to one of her bosses. She was offered the chance to work on a soft launch of a new site because of her skills.
